April 2026 MPA Student of the Month: William Gordon

William Gordon is a Master of Public Administration student at the University of Georgia in his final semester of the program. He earned his undergraduate degree in Political Science and Leadership from Western Carolina University, where he first developed a strong interest in public service. Throughout his academic career, William has cultivated a commitment to public administration and aspires to serve in the federal government, with a focus on policy and public service at the national level.

During his time at UGA, William has developed a broad academic foundation in international policy, economic policy, and criminal justice. He has intentionally approached his studies as a generalist in public administration, seeking to build a versatile and comprehensive understanding of complex policy issues across multiple domains. In the summer of 2025, he completed an internship with the Clarke County Sheriff’s Office, where he gained exposure to a wide range of law enforcement operations. This experience reinforced his interest in public safety and has influenced his plans to begin his professional career in law enforcement while maintaining a long-term interest in federal service.

William’s academic achievements reflect his dedication and work ethic. He has maintained a 3.9 GPA throughout his graduate studies and will be inducted into Pi Alpha Alpha, the national honor society for public affairs and administration, in May. He also completed the Carl Vinson Institute of Government’s Professional Development Program in Fall 2025, further strengthening his leadership and professional skill set. As a first-generation graduate student, he takes particular pride in these accomplishments and the path they represent.
